negligible
/'neglɪdʒəbl; `nɛˇlədʒəbl/
adj of little importance or size; not worth considering 不重要的; 很小的; 不值得考虑的
*a negligible amount, error, effect 微不足道的数量、错误、作用
* Losses in trade this year were negligible. 今年的交易损失无足轻重.
